11:47 — The Harkvale team completed the cutover of the user module out of the Pellwright monolith. Reads had been dual-served for two weeks; writes flipped at this timestamp behind the routing flag. We observed a brief spike in session lookups as caches warmed, resolved by 11:58 without intervention. Note for future maintainers: the legacy user tables remain in the monolith database, frozen but not dropped, pending the Q3 archival review. The migration was validated against the canary build identified by the token below.

pipeline stamp: htk9_ce63042d9

This page summarises our evaluation of Querro Systems, a mid-sized analytics firm based in Delwick. Diligence to date covers financials, key-person risk, and integration costs; findings are broadly favourable, though their Merrowline product carries unresolved licensing questions. Valuation discussions remain preliminary and no term sheet has been exchanged. The incoming director should review the diligence folder before the next steering meeting. The confidential business rationale for proceeding is recorded directly below.

board note of bahaf-kahif: Gross margin on Wenael came in at 10 percent against a plan of 15 percent. Only 7 of the 120 pilot accounts renewed Wenael, so a churn review is set for July 1.

# Document Transport: Archiving Paper Ledgers

Closed paper ledgers from the Tarwick floor must be boxed, indexed, and strapped before transfer to the Ellwood Archive. The shift lead verifies the index sheet, seals each box, and records seal numbers in the transport log. Collection is weekly by arranged courier. The confidential hand-over instruction follows immediately below.

courier memo of yagug-fahip: the pelys tameth courier leaves the silys ledger at gate 7827 under passcode 926220